MARQUIS OF HUNTLY'S STRATHSPEY [2]. AKA - "Marquis of Huntly's New Strathspey." Scottish, Strathspey (whole time). F Major. Standard tuning (fiddle). AAB. "Marquis of Huntly's new Strathspey" was composed by Edinburgh fiddler-composer and bandleader biography:Robert Mackintosh (c. 1745-1808) and was printed in his Fourth Collection of New Strathspey Reels (c. 1804).
